DC-3 Society Celebrates 90 Years of the ‘Gooney Bird’

Summary by Flying
On December 17, 1903, the Wright brothers made their first powered flight at Kitty Hawk, North Carolina, and those 12 seconds changed the world. But did you know that just 32 years later, on the same day in 1935, the Douglas DC-3 made its first flight?
